Fire suppression action plans must admit:
Fire reporting ways – How employees will be alerted in a fire emergency and how they should report it must be addressed. If there are handicapped or disabled workers, there special requirements should also be considered.
Processes for evacuation – Supplemental danger, hurt and disarray is the result of chaotic evacuation programs and routines.
Escape routes and designations – Indicating evacuation regions, escape paths and putting up floor programs are needed.
Listing of contact persons and contact information in the section or for the entire business.
Description of duties and responsibilties of key staff during fire emergencies
Availability of processes for employees who are required to close down vital operations, operate emergency equipment including fire suppressants.
Medical and rescue duties to be done by key employees
Employee training on initial aid, emergency response processes and evacuation and accountability processes
